Short answer

Loong Air publishes an official dangerous-goods table with power-bank and spare-lithium-battery handling. Power banks up to 100 Wh are prohibited in checked baggage and allowed in hand baggage or on-person carriage when protected against short circuit; power banks over 100 Wh through 160 Wh require Loong Air approval, remain cabin/on-person only, and are limited to two. Power banks over 160 Wh are not allowed, and power banks may not be used in flight and must remain switched off.
